Yes I read it. McElroy is a really good storyteller. The latter part of the book becomes very engrossing. Though the initial 200 pages is hard to get through due to the experimental nature of parts of the text. McElroy employs a second person stream of consciousness. The subject matter doesn’t make sense because I believe it’s angels interrogating someone on the events of the main character’s life. So it’s very hard to follow but makes more sense upon completion or a second reading. There are some very titillating and entertaining parts: a lengthy description of a woman masturbating, and this same woman hosts a soul searching yoga/sexual exploration club in the nude. It’s really good and has lots of characters whose story arcs interconnect. It all comes together towards the end.
